WebJan 30, 2024 · What if my cyanuric acid is too high? A high level of cyanuric acid can cause a condition called chlorine lock, which basically means that your chlorine has been rendered useless by it. Even after adding chlorine to the pool, a chlorination test will show very little chlorine or no chlorine at all. Does Rain lower cyanuric acid? WebHigh cyanuric acid can be caused by too much chronic stabilizer, algaecides, or pool water supply from local municipalities already containing cyanuric acid. Too much cyanuric acid can harm the chlorine effectiveness of your pool, cause inaccurate alkalinity readings, and … WebMay 5, 2024 · Cyanuric acid acts as a pool stabilizer to protect chlorine from the sun’s UV rays. Without a pool stabilizer, the UV rays can destroy your chlorine within a matter of hours. But, if you have too much cyanuric acid, the chlorine won’t be able to sanitize your water as effectively.
